看板 [ java ]
討論串[問題] DAO 模式
共 4 篇文章
首頁
上一頁
1
下一頁
尾頁

推噓0(0推 0噓 0→)留言0則,0人參與, 最新作者etman395 (技術時代)時間15年前 (2009/05/26 15:01), 編輯資訊
1
0
0
內容預覽:
我實在很不了解dao模式. 我只知道他的作用好像是不要在jsp裡面寫sql代碼. 把他分離出來. 這樣jsp就會省掉很多重覆的sql代碼. 然後為了換資料庫不會影響前台代碼. 所以做個 dao介面 和實作dao的類別 然後再寫個封裝資料表的類別. 上面這段我理解的很模糊. 其實我dao還是沒有懂..

推噓2(2推 0噓 0→)留言2則,0人參與, 最新作者adrianshum (Alien)時間15年前 (2009/05/26 15:39), 編輯資訊
1
0
0
內容預覽:
DAO 簡而言之, 就是我寫的logic 不用再管. CRUD 的部份, 把 CRUD 交給一個 DAO. 某程度. 上, 我的 logic 就不再需要理會背後用什麼. persistence technology, 以後想比如換用別的. DB, 只要換別的 DAO Impl 就好了. 感覺上就像:
(還有443個字)

推噓8(8推 0噓 2→)留言10則,0人參與, 最新作者etman395 (技術時代)時間15年前 (2009/05/26 16:25), 編輯資訊
1
0
0
內容預覽:
噗. 謝謝解說= =. 我的理解是這樣. 有問題糾正我一下 謝謝= =. 一個dao介面抽象出所有資料表裡面可能操作的方法. 再一個實作dao介面的類別實作出. 然後再寫一個user類別封裝該資料表 user表. 接著把使用者的參數放該user類別. 然後呼叫 實作dao介面方法插user類別 之後
(還有44個字)

推噓2(2推 0噓 0→)留言2則,0人參與, 最新作者qrtt1 (null)時間15年前 (2009/05/30 22:43), 編輯資訊
0
0
2
內容預覽:
基本上的理解大致是對的,但是少了點什麼。. 缺少的是 pattern 互動的角色,以致內心戲的劇本無法完整演譯。. 為什麼要有 dao pattern?可以先問自己一個基本的問題。. pattern 是有系統地整理前人開發經驗的結果,. 回顧開發歷程,最令人痛苦的是需求「變更」帶來的實作改變。. 對
(還有2410個字)
首頁
上一頁
1
下一頁
尾頁